•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

lsm / neokai / 26605530874
82%

Build:
DEFAULT BRANCH: dev
Ran 28 May 2026 10:18PM UTC
Jobs 28
Files 572
Run time 2min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

28 May 2026 10:17PM UTC coverage: 83.253%. First build
26605530874

push

github

web-flow
Rebalance daemon unit test shards (#2038)

* test: rebalance daemon unit shards

Split storage and runtime hotspots while merging smaller daemon shards to bring parallel wall times into a tighter range.

* ci: update daemon shard matrix

Keep CI matrix names aligned with the rebalanced daemon test shards and restore omitted migration coverage.

* test: restore daemon shard coverage

Include root space tests, auto-discover migration tests, and document a current shard name so local commands match the rebalanced script.

* Gate space task RPC handler test coverage (#2031)

* test: gate space task handler coverage

Require modified spaceTask RPC handlers to have matching handler-path tests before PRs can pass CI.

* fix: harden handler test gate

Fetch full history in CI, skip unavailable local comparison refs, and require actual handler test calls.

* test: cover pending completion RPC handler

Add direct handler-path tests so the space task handler coverage gate passes existing handlers without false positives.

* fix: ignore disabled handler tests in gate

Strip comments and skipped test bodies before collecting handler-path calls so only executable tests satisfy coverage.

* fix: test handler gate in CI

Run the coverage gate when handler tests change, execute the gate parser tests in CI, and keep current knip ignores explicit.

* fix: require executed handler test calls

Only count top-level executed handler call statements inside enabled tests, and reject wrapped non-executed call helpers.

* fix: reject nested handler coverage

* fix: resolve timestamp race in goal-automation cursor test

The cursor upsert staleness guard compares lastFiredAt with >=, so
when two automation jobs execute within the same millisecond the stale
write's lastFiredAt equals the stored value and the guard lets it
through. Use cursor1.lastFiredAt - 1 to guarantee strictly older.

9320 of 13718 branches covered (67.94%)

Branch coverage included in aggregate %.

80211 of 93823 relevant lines covered (85.49%)

301.55 hits per line

Jobs
ID Job ID Ran Files Coverage
1 daemon-online-agent-sdk - 26605530874.1 28 May 2026 10:19PM UTC 326
22.36
GitHub Action Run
2 daemon-0-shared-handlers-workflow - 26605530874.2 28 May 2026 10:18PM UTC 156
65.45
GitHub Action Run
3 web - 26605530874.3 28 May 2026 10:19PM UTC 237
73.23
GitHub Action Run
4 daemon-online-rewind-1 - 26605530874.4 28 May 2026 10:19PM UTC 326
22.52
GitHub Action Run
5 daemon-online-space-2 - 26605530874.5 28 May 2026 10:20PM UTC 326
32.81
GitHub Action Run
6 daemon-online-rpc-4 - 26605530874.6 28 May 2026 10:19PM UTC 326
23.37
GitHub Action Run
7 daemon-online-rpc-3 - 26605530874.7 28 May 2026 10:18PM UTC 326
19.78
GitHub Action Run
8 daemon-5-space-agent-other - 26605530874.8 28 May 2026 10:18PM UTC 265
26.83
GitHub Action Run
9 daemon-online-sdk - 26605530874.9 28 May 2026 10:18PM UTC 326
22.37
GitHub Action Run
10 daemon-4-space-migrations-b - 26605530874.10 28 May 2026 10:18PM UTC 77
36.02
GitHub Action Run
11 daemon-online-space-1 - 26605530874.11 28 May 2026 10:19PM UTC 326
33.86
GitHub Action Run
12 daemon-5-space-runtime-b - 26605530874.12 28 May 2026 10:18PM UTC 174
43.01
GitHub Action Run
13 daemon-online-rpc-2 - 26605530874.13 28 May 2026 10:19PM UTC 326
23.55
GitHub Action Run
14 daemon-online-features-1 - 26605530874.14 28 May 2026 10:19PM UTC 326
23.17
GitHub Action Run
15 daemon-online-convo - 26605530874.15 28 May 2026 10:19PM UTC 326
22.25
GitHub Action Run
16 daemon-1-core - 26605530874.16 28 May 2026 10:18PM UTC 332
35.98
GitHub Action Run
17 daemon-online-rewind-2 - 26605530874.17 28 May 2026 10:19PM UTC 326
22.97
GitHub Action Run
18 daemon-online-git - 26605530874.18 28 May 2026 10:18PM UTC 326
19.13
GitHub Action Run
19 daemon-4-space-migrations-a - 26605530874.19 28 May 2026 10:18PM UTC 45
58.86
GitHub Action Run
20 daemon-online-mcp - 26605530874.20 28 May 2026 10:18PM UTC 326
18.5
GitHub Action Run
21 daemon-5-space-runtime-a - 26605530874.21 28 May 2026 10:18PM UTC 126
38.53
GitHub Action Run
22 daemon-online-rpc-1 - 26605530874.22 28 May 2026 10:19PM UTC 326
19.38
GitHub Action Run
23 daemon-online-websocket - 26605530874.23 28 May 2026 10:18PM UTC 326
18.23
GitHub Action Run
24 daemon-4-space-storage - 26605530874.24 28 May 2026 10:18PM UTC 150
56.15
GitHub Action Run
25 daemon-online-components - 26605530874.25 28 May 2026 10:18PM UTC 326
18.13
GitHub Action Run
26 daemon-online-lifecycle - 26605530874.26 28 May 2026 10:19PM UTC 326
22.79
GitHub Action Run
27 daemon-online-coordinator - 26605530874.27 28 May 2026 10:18PM UTC 326
7.76
GitHub Action Run
28 daemon-online-features-2 - 26605530874.28 28 May 2026 10:19PM UTC 326
22.7
GitHub Action Run
Source Files on build 26605530874
  • Tree
  • List 572
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Repo
  • Github Actions Build #26605530874
  • 812d2fec on github
  • Prev Build on dev (#26604834181)
  • Next Build on dev (#26606385682)
  • Delete
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c